1. Who we are
EspressoDesk operates the helpdesk platform described at espressodesk.com. For account and website data we act as a data controller. For the ticket, chat and contact data your agents handle inside a workspace we act as a data processor on your instructions.

2. Data we collect
Account data: name, work email, organisation, language preference, role and authentication identifiers.
Billing data: plan, subscription status and invoice history. Card details are entered on Lemon Squeezy's checkout and never reach our servers.
Service data: tickets, chat transcripts, internal notes, knowledge base articles and the email addresses of the end customers you support.
Technical data: IP address, browser and device metadata, and audit logs used for security and abuse prevention.

4. Subprocessors we share data with
Supabase — hosting of the application database, authentication and file storage.
Lovable — application hosting, platform e-mail delivery for account and notification messages, and the AI gateway that routes text submitted to the AI assistant features (tone improvement, summaries, auto-drafts) to the underlying model providers. Content is sent for inference only and is not used to train models.
Lemon Squeezy — merchant of record for checkout, subscriptions, invoices and tax handling.
Your own mail provider — when you connect a company mailbox (Gmail, Microsoft 365, any IMAP/SMTP host, or a sending API such as Postmark, SendGrid, Resend or Brevo), customer e-mail is retrieved from and sent through that mailbox. That provider is your own subprocessor under your contract with them; we only hold the access credentials, encrypted with AES-256-GCM, and act on your instructions.
Each subprocessor we engage is bound by a written data processing agreement. We publish material changes to this list before they take effect.
5. International transfers
Some subprocessors are located in the United States. Transfers out of the EEA or the UK rely on the EU Standard Contractual Clauses and the UK Addendum, together with supplementary technical measures such as encryption in transit and at rest.
6. Retention
Workspace content is kept while the subscription is active and for 30 days after cancellation, then deleted from live systems and purged from backups within 90 days.
Invoices and tax records are retained for the period required by law. Security logs are kept for 12 months.

8. Security
Data is encrypted in transit with TLS and at rest. Tenant isolation is enforced at the database layer with row-level security so one organisation can never read another's tickets.
Access to production data is limited to staff who need it, protected by multi-factor authentication and logged. We will notify affected customers of a personal data breach without undue delay and within 72 hours where legally required.
